Polymer composites reinforced with carbon nanotubes (CNTs) demonstrate significant improvements in mechanical characteristics. The incorporation of CNTs, due to their exceptional stiffness, can lead to a substantial elevation in click here the composite's compressive strength, modulus, and impact resistance. This augmentation stems from the synergistic interaction between the CNTs and the polymer matrix. The orientation of CNTs within the composite framework plays a crucial role in dictating the final mechanical efficacy.

Optimizing the manufacturing parameters, such as fiber content, aspect ratio, and dispersion technique, is essential to achieve maximum advantage from CNT reinforcement. Studies continue to explore novel strategies for enhancing the mechanical performance of CNT polymer composites, paving the way for their widespread adoption in various high-performance applications.

Carbon Nanotube-Based Composites for High-Performance Applications

Carbon nanotube (CNT)-based composites have emerged as a promising material class due to their exceptional mechanical, electrical, and thermal properties. The inherent durability of CNTs, coupled with their outstanding aspect ratio, allows for significant enhancement in the performance of traditional composite materials. These composites find deployment in a wide range of high-performance fields, including aerospace, automotive, and energy storage.

Furthermore, CNT-based composites exhibit improved conductivity and thermal management, making them suitable for applications requiring efficient heat dissipation or electrical conduction. The versatility of CNTs, coupled with their ability to be functionalized, allows for the design of composites with targeted properties to meet the demands of various sectors.

Structural Properties of CNT Composite Materials: A Comprehensive Analysis

Carbon nanotube (CNT) composites have gained significant attention in recent years due to their exceptional physical properties. The incorporation of CNTs into a matrix can result in a marked enhancement in strength, stiffness, and toughness. The distribution of CNTs within the matrix plays a crucial role in determining the overall efficacy of the composite. Factors such as CNT length, diameter, and chirality can influence the strength, modulus, and fatigue behavior of the composite material.

  • Several experimental and theoretical studies have been conducted to investigate the structural properties of CNT composites.
  • This investigations have revealed that the orientation, aspect ratio, and concentration of CNTs can significantly influence the structural response of the composite.
  • The interface between the CNTs and the matrix is also a key factor that affects the overall effectiveness of the composite.

A thorough understanding of the structural properties of CNT composites is essential for enhancing their performance in various fields.

CNT Composite Materials: Recent Advances and Future Directions

Carbon nanotube (CNT) composite materials have emerged as a significant field of research due to their exceptional mechanical, electrical, and thermal properties. Recent advancements in CNT synthesis, processing, and characterization have led to groundbreaking improvements in the performance of CNT composites. These advances include the development of novel fabrication methods for large-scale production of high-quality CNTs, as well as improved strategies for incorporating CNTs into various matrix materials. Moreover, researchers are actively exploring the potential of CNT composites in a diverse range of applications, including aerospace, automotive, biomedical, and energy sectors.

Future research directions in this evolving field focus on overcoming key challenges such as economical production of CNTs, improving the dispersion and interfacial bonding between CNTs and matrix materials, and developing industrializable manufacturing processes. The integration of CNT composites with other advanced materials holds immense potential for creating next-generation materials with customized properties. These ongoing efforts are expected to accelerate the development of innovative CNT composite materials with transformative applications in various industries.
